The invention belongs to the technical field of water quality detection, and discloses an unmanned ship-based water quality detection system, which comprises an unmanned ship walking in a to-be-detected water area and a navigation positioning module arranged on the unmanned ship, and the unmanned ship is further provided with a water sample collection module, a water quality detection module, a water quality analysis module and a control module. According to the unmanned ship-based water quality detection system, the water sample collection module, the water quality detection module, the waterquality analysis module and the control module are arranged on the unmanned ship, the water sample collection module collects a water sample, the water quality detection module detects the water sample to obtain detection data, and the water quality analysis module analyzes the detection data to obtain a water quality analysis result; finally, the result is uploaded to a remote monitoring centerthrough the control module, workers do not need to go to the site, and the personal safety of the workers can be effectively guaranteed; sampling, detection and analysis are completed on site in realtime, the period is short, timeliness is high, and data reliability and accuracy can be improved.
